This paper examines the multinational corporations-government nexus. It derives policy implications to the catch-up process of developing host countries and explores international business in comparison with mainstream theory. The paper reviews the 'mechanisms' of endogenous growth introduced in the mainstream economics and then identifies relevant work in the international business field.
